| 备注 |
Zygmunt Kalinowski (1926–2022) was a Polish veteran of the Warsaw Uprising who became one of the longest-lived survivors of that 63-day insurrection against German occupation. This souvenir zero-euro note was issued in the year of his death, a detail that gives the commemorative purpose a particular weight. The Eurosouvenirs program, operating under ECB license since 2012, has issued hundreds of such pieces — but subjects tied to living or recently deceased witnesses to 20th-century atrocities are relatively rare in the catalog.
Oberthur Fiduciaire's involvement ensures genuine security features rather than the purely decorative treatments used by unlicensed souvenir printers.
